Optimizing Solar Panel Performance: The Importance of Tilt Mounts for Hill Area Installations
Jun 18,2026
In hilly areas, the installation of photovoltaic (PV) systems requires careful consideration of several factors to ensure optimal performance. One of the most effective solutions for maximizing solar energy capture in these environments is the use of tilt mounts. These mounts allow solar panels to be adjusted at various angles, ensuring they are oriented correctly relative to the sun’s path. This versatility is particularly essential in hilly regions, where varying elevations and slopes can significantly impact the amount of sunlight received by solar panels.
The primary advantage of tilt mounts in hilly areas is their ability to optimize the angle of solar panels. Fixed-angled panels may not capture the maximum amount of solar energy due to the sun’s changing position throughout the day and the year. Tilt mounts enable installers to adjust the panels to the optimal angle for different seasons, thereby enhancing energy production. By utilizing these mounts, solar installations can achieve significant improvements in overall efficiency, which is particularly crucial in regions where sunlight availability might be inconsistent due to the topography.
Additionally, tilt mounts can aid in reducing shading effects that are common in hilly areas. When solar panels are positioned at a fixed angle, surrounding structures, trees, or even terrain can cast shadows that diminish their performance. With adjustable tilt mounts, installers can strategically position the panels to minimize these shading effects, ensuring that they receive maximum direct sunlight exposure throughout the day.
Moreover, tilt mounts offer flexibility in design and installation, allowing professionals to tailor solutions based on the specific characteristics of the site. They can be customized to accommodate varying slopes and heights, making them ideal for challenging terrains. This adaptability not only enhances the installation process but also ensures that the solar systems can be optimized for long-term performance.
